The success of any Hajj operation extends beyond transportation, accommodation, and healthcare. An equally important component of pilgrims’ welfare is the provision of quality meals. For thousands of Kano pilgrims currently performing Hajj in the Holy Land, Na’ima Idris Kitchen has established itself as a dependable catering provider, delivering nutritious, well-prepared, and timely meals throughout the pilgrimage period.

 

Since the commencement of this year’s Hajj exercise, numerous Kano pilgrims have expressed satisfaction with the catering services provided by the kitchen. Pilgrims interviewed in Makkah described the meals as flavorful, hygienically prepared, and reflective of the dietary preferences and culinary traditions familiar to people from Kano State.

 

Among the attributes most frequently cited by pilgrims is the kitchen’s commitment to punctual service delivery. Despite the logistical challenges associated with catering for large numbers of pilgrims in Makkah during the Hajj season, meals have reportedly been delivered consistently and on schedule, helping pilgrims maintain their strength and well-being before and after carrying out their religious obligations.

 

Several pilgrims also praised the management and staff for maintaining high standards of consistency in both meal quality and portion size. According to their accounts, the meals are not only satisfying but are also prepared with careful attention to taste, hygiene, and nutritional value—factors that are particularly important during the physically demanding Hajj rites.
